Toyota RAV4 (XA40) 2013-2018 Owners Manual: Listening to bluetooth® audio

The bluetooth® audio system enables the user to enjoy music played on a portable player from the vehicle speakers via wireless communication.

When a bluetooth® device cannot be connected, check the connection status on the “bluetooth* audio” screen. If the device is not connected, either register or reconnect the device.

Status display

You can check such indicators as signal strength and battery charge on the screen.

  1. Connection status
  2. Battery charge

The battery charge indicator may not be displayed depending on the connected device.
